North Arrow Minerals Inc (NAR) - Total Liabilities
Based on the latest financial reports, North Arrow Minerals Inc (NAR) has total liabilities worth CA$268.97K CAD (≈ $194.57K USD) as of October 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 2.50 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 0.01 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.01 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for North Arrow Minerals Inc (2007–2025)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of North Arrow Minerals Inc from 2007 to 2025.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-04-30 | CA$289.70K ≈ $209.57K |
-76.01% |
| 2024-04-30 | CA$1.21 Million ≈ $873.59K |
+5.87% |
| 2023-04-30 | CA$1.14 Million ≈ $825.12K |
-36.70% |
| 2022-04-30 | CA$1.80 Million ≈ $1.30 Million |
+12.08% |
| 2021-04-30 | CA$1.61 Million ≈ $1.16 Million |
+234.05% |
| 2020-04-30 | CA$481.26K ≈ $348.14K |
-3.07% |
| 2019-04-30 | CA$496.52K ≈ $359.17K |
+13.49% |
| 2018-04-30 | CA$437.50K ≈ $316.48K |
+426.45% |
| 2017-04-30 | CA$83.10K ≈ $60.12K |
-86.35% |
| 2016-04-30 | CA$608.67K ≈ $440.30K |
+118.59% |
| 2015-04-30 | CA$278.45K ≈ $201.43K |
-27.01% |
| 2014-04-30 | CA$381.51K ≈ $275.98K |
+13.95% |
| 2013-04-30 | CA$334.81K ≈ $242.20K |
-70.24% |
| 2012-04-30 | CA$1.12 Million ≈ $813.77K |
+769.06% |
| 2011-04-30 | CA$129.44K ≈ $93.64K |
-32.52% |
| 2010-04-30 | CA$191.84K ≈ $138.77K |
+82.95% |
| 2009-04-30 | CA$104.86K ≈ $75.85K |
-89.98% |
| 2008-04-30 | CA$1.05 Million ≈ $756.65K |
+1373.99% |
| 2007-04-30 | CA$70.96K ≈ $51.33K |
-- |
About North Arrow Minerals Inc
North Arrow Minerals Inc. engages in the acquisition and exploration of mineral properties in Canada and Botswana. The company explores for lithium, diamond, and gold properties. The company was incorporated in 2007 and is based in Vancouver, Canada.
